Extension: increasing the angle between two bones

a.
Flexion: decreasing the angle between two bones

a.
Abduction: Moving away from the midline

b.
Adduction: Moving towards the midline

a.
Medial rotation: rotating toward central axis

b.
Lateral rotation: rotating away central axis

a.
Circumduction: Limb moves in a circle, End of limb/point of attachment remains stationary

b.
Supination : Moving palms from posterior to anterior

a.
Pronation: Moving palms from anterior to posterior

a.
Elevation: Vertical motion, superiorly

b.
Depression: Vertical motion, inferiorly

b.
Plantarflexion: Movement of the foot as the heel elevates

a.
Dorsiflexion: Movement of the foot as the heel is depressed

a.
Inversion: Lift the sole of the foot medially

b.
Eversion: Lift the sole of the foot laterally

Opposition: Thumb touches the finger tips
